The Spectravideo SVI-318 and SVI-328 personal computers, introduced in 1982–1983, use a 5-pin DIN 180° (DIN41524) female socket on their rear panel to carry composite video, mono audio, and power for an optional RF modulator. The connector is labelled the “RF port” in Spectravideo’s own documentation; the supplied cable breaks the signals out to two separate RCA phono plugs, one for composite video and one for audio. Composite video is generated by the TMS-9918A (NTSC) or TMS-9929 (PAL) video display processor, while audio is produced by the on-board PSG, which offers three independently controlled tone channels.
| Pin | Name | Description |
|---|---|---|
| 1 | +5v | Power |
| 2 | GND | System ground |
| 3 | AUDIO | Audio out |
| 4 | VIDEO | Composite Video out |
| 5 | RF VID | RF Video out |
Signals
- +5v — +5 V supply, provided on pin 1 to power an externally connected RF modulator unit.
- GND — System ground reference for all signals on the connector.
- AUDIO — Mono audio output from the PSG (three-channel tone generator), mixed to a single signal.
- VIDEO — NTSC or PAL composite video output from the TMS-9918A/TMS-9929 VDP.
- RF VID — RF-modulated video signal for connection to a television aerial input.
Notes
The socket on the computer is a 5-pin DIN 180° (DIN41524) female. The standard Spectravideo video/audio cable terminates in a matching 5-pin DIN 180° male plug at the computer end and splits to two RCA phono plugs at the other end: one for composite video (pin 4) and one for audio (pin 3). Pin 1 supplies +5 V to operate an RF modulator accessory when connected; this voltage is not present on the RCA breakout cable. The PAL RF modulator circuit is documented in schematic STM-013-A of the Spectravideo service manual.
